#988e24 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#988e24 is composed of 59.6% red, 55.7%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6.6% magenta, 76.3%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 54.8 degrees, a saturation of 61.7% and a lightness of 36.9%. #988e24 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ff48 with #311d00.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

Shades and Tints of #988e24

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090902 is the darkest color, while #fdfd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#988e24

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e5e5e is the less saturated color, while #b5a607 is the most saturated one.
